Coastal Heritage Society announces new STEAM Center at Savannah Children’s Museum

Wednesday, May 14th, 2025

Coming soon: the STEAM Center at Savannah Children’s Museum!

Coastal Heritage Society is proud to announce the first indoor expansion of Savannah Children’s Museum!

Learn more about the STEAM Center and sign up for exclusive updates here,

The Savannah Children’s Museum will have its first indoor space by the end of 2025.

The STEAM Center at Savannah Children’s Museum will be housed in the historic storehouse building at the neighboring Georgia State Railroad Museum, a museum also operated by Coastal Heritage Society.

The 100-year-old industrial building is being transformed into a modern learning environment, which will house an exhibit called “Numbers in Nature,” an innovative STEAM exhibition scheduled to open in late 2025. This interactive experience makes complex concepts accessible by revealing the mathematical patterns found all around us—in nature, music, art, and architecture.

Featured in the exhibition is an 1,800-square-foot Mirror Maze of repeating triangles, reflections, and illusions. Visitors will navigate the maze and uncover the secrets hidden inside- including the way out.

(Savannah Summer Camps 2025) Computer Science & Engineering program for high schoolers

Monday, May 12th, 2025

Georgia Tech Savannah Computational & Data Science Engineering Program for High Schoolers

Seth Bonder Camp is at Georgia Tech Savannah this summer for 9th – 12th graders, July 7th – 11th, 2025!

The Seth Bonder Summer Program in Computational and Data Science Engineering is intended for high school students interested in computer science and engineering who have no or minimal background in data science and computer programming.

The program only requires that participants can use a browser and have a desire to learn computational and data science through meaningful and exciting applications in machine learning, optimization, computational social science, and genomics. The Level 1 program allows students to start from Level 1 with the Snap! visual programming language. The key computational concepts are introduced using a small robot (“Karel the Robot”) navigating in a grid world. Lunch is included in the cost!

Dates: July 7th – 11th, 2025

Times: 8:30 am – 3 pm

Cost: $325

Ages: 9th – 12th Grade

Lunches are provided.

Savannah 8th grade students invited to apply to Savannah Scholars for college application support

Wednesday, May 7th, 2025

Savannah Scholars

Let Savannah Scholars help improve your high school student’s access to and graduation from a best-fit college!

Savannah Scholars is a free, eight-year comprehensive program. Applicants who are accepted into the program are inducted in the fall of their high school freshman year. Students in the program are then supported and advised throughout high school.

Savannah Scholars provides the following:

*Informative workshops that build a student’s and family’s college knowledge

*Peer support through a positive cohort of like-minded students

*1:1 mentoring, starting sophomore year

*College visits all four years of high school

*Free ACT test preparation

*Access to on-campus, pre-college seminars and classes

*Individualized college counseling, including the application and selection processes

*Ongoing persistence counseling to ensure a positive transition to and through college

SCAD presents The Drowsy Chaperone musical @ Lucas Theatre, Savannah

Monday, May 5th, 2025

The Drowsy Chaperone musical @ Lucas Theatre in Savannah

Step into a Broadway time capsule with The Drowsy Chaperone, presented by SCAD’s School of Film and Acting, May 22 – 25 2025 at the Lucas Theatre in Savannah.

The Drowsy Chaperone is a musical-within-a-musical that brings the glitz and glamour of 1920s Broadway to life. Running from May 22–25 at Savannah’s historic Lucas Theatre for the Arts, this Tony Award-winning comedy follows a lonely theater enthusiast—known only as “Man in Chair”—who escapes into the world of his favorite forgotten musical.

As he plays the original cast recording, the show bursts into life in his apartment, complete with mistaken identities, tap-dancing groomsmen, and a delightfully tipsy chaperone. Don’t miss this whimsical journey through Broadway’s past!
